Abstract

We propose a method of information extraction from HTML documents based on modelling the visual information in the document. A page segmentation algorithm is used for detecting the document layout and subsequently, the extraction process is based on the analysis of mutual positions of the detected blocks and their visual features. This approach is more robust that the traditional DOM-based methods and it opens new possibilities for the extraction task specification.
